Trail Overview
Looking Glass is a 33.9-mile point-to-point trail that serves as the main (and only) route through this section of the Umatilla National Forest, connecting the town of Troy to Looking Glass - FS 63. The trail is a winding, single-lane road that provides access to numerous spur trails, viewpoints, and dispersed camping opportunities. While there is evidence of many spur trails, several are closed to motorized vehicles; refer to the Pomeroy District MVUM for the Umatilla National Forest for current access information. The route is restricted to highway-legal vehicles only. Looking Glass - Troy is open year-round.

Difficulty
As a winding, single-lane gravel road, Looking Glass - Troy is suitable for most 2WD and low-clearance vehicles when maintained during seasonal maintenance. Weather conditions, such as rain or snow, can significantly impact the difficulty. As with most trails in the area, bringing a chainsaw or equipment to clear fallen trees is recommended.
